docker-compose.yml 442 B

12345678910111213141516171819202122
  1. version: "3.9"
  2. services:
  3. mysql:
  4. image: mysql:5.7
  5. environment:
  6. - MYSQL_ROOT_PASSWORD=root
  7. - MYSQL_DATABASE=distschedule
  8. ports:
  9. - "3306:3306"
  10. rabbitmq:
  11. image: rabbitmq:3.6.10-management-alpine
  12. ports:
  13. - "15672:15672"
  14. distschedule:
  15. image: distschedule
  16. environment:
  17. - SPRING_PROFILES_ACTIVE=dockercompose
  18. ports:
  19. - "8080:8080"
  20. depends_on:
  21. - mysql
  22. - rabbitmq